A close up of the block and the stitching. I used a monofilament thread for the
ditch work and a white polyester thread for the background motif. Although it
the motif looks complicated, it is quite simple. A loop de loop that looks great
when it is done.

Evelyn also created this beauty for her son. She wasn’t sure of what to stitch onto
the top but straight lines work every time and make it feel more masculine.
The blocks, up close and personal. I used a grey polyester thread for the top and the
backing.
